Our apprenticeship programme for orphans and vulnerable children (OVC) is opening doors for out-of-school youth across the districts we serve.

Participants train hands-on in trades such as tailoring, mechanics, masonry and hairdressing — practical skills that translate directly into income and independence.

Combined with our socio-economic strengthening work — income generation training, small business development and market information — the programme helps families affected by HIV/AIDS become food and income secure.
